Abstract

Tetraselmis sp. merupakan salah satu mikroalga yang potensial untuk dibudidayakan sebagai pakan alami. Siklus hidup Tetraselmis sp. sangat dipengaruhi oleh fase adaptasi atau fase lag. Pada fase lag, kondisi lingkungan mempengaruhi lamanya waktu fase lag, yang berimplikasi terhadap semakin lamanya waktu kultur Tetraselmis sp. Perlu dilakukan suatu usaha untuk mempercepat waktu kultur, salah satu caranya adalah memanipulasi lingkungan dengan cara pengurangan nitrat anorganik (NaNO3) pada pupuk Conwy. Penelitian dilakukan pada tanggal 1-12 Juli 2014 bertempat di Laboratorium Budidaya Perairan Fakultas Pertanian Universitas Lampung. Berdasarkan hasil uji t yang diperoleh dari penelitian menunjukkan bahwa pengurangan nitrat anorganik (NaNO3) pada pupuk Conwy belum memberikan pengaruh yang nyata terhadap kepadatan Tetraselmis sp. dan kosentrasi nitrat anorganik pada media kultur. Kondisi kekurangan kadar nitrat (NO3-), akan cenderung lebih mempengaruhi proses pembentukan protein dibandingkan dengan pertumbuhan sel Tetraselmis sp. The life cycle of Tetraselmis sp. greatly influenced by the adaptation phase or lag phase. During the lag phase, environmental conditions can affect the duration of the lag phase, which linier implications for increasing of culture time of Tetraselmis sp. The effort to cut off the culture time should be needed by manipulating the environment variable (such as reduction of inorganic nitrate (NaNO3) in Conwy medium). The study was conducted on 1-12 July 2014 held at the Laboratory of Aquaculture, Faculty of Agriculture, University of Lampung. The result showed that the reduction of inorganic nitrate (NaNO3) in Conwy medium has not significant effect on the density of Tetraselmis sp., either in the concentration of inorganic nitrate in the culture medium. By the time, the nitrogen starvation condition the culture medium tend gave specific responses on Tetraselms sp. Specific respons showed that microalgae Tetraselmis sp tend to produce protein rather than to increase cell growth.
